Hi,
I sometimes see 0 byte recordings. When I see one every recording after it is 0 byte until I reboot the box.

syslog messages when the tuners die
Code:
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798614] irq 18: nobody cared (try booting with the "irqpoll" option)
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798626] Pid: 30780, comm: FahCore_a3.exe Tainted: P 2.6.35-25-generic #44-Ubuntu
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798628] Call Trace:
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798630] <IRQ> [<ffffffff810cbc1b>] __report_bad_irq+0x2b/0xa0
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798638] [<ffffffff810cbe1c>] note_interrupt+0x18c/0x1d0
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798642] [<ffffffff8102cd89>] ? ack_apic_level+0x79/0x1b0
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798645] [<ffffffff810cc61d>] handle_fasteoi_irq+0xdd/0x110
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798648] [<ffffffff8100cb12>] handle_irq+0x22/0x30
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798651] [<ffffffff815921ec>] do_IRQ+0x6c/0xf0
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798655] [<ffffffff8158add3>] ret_from_intr+0x0/0x11
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798656] <EOI>
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798658] handlers:
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798662] [<ffffffffa0a96380>] (interrupt_hw+0x0/0x2b0 [saa7146])
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798681] [<ffffffffa005d890>] (sil24_interrupt+0x0/0x1ac [sata_sil24])
Feb 22 01:19:25 alpha2 kernel: [116475.798695] Disabling IRQ #18
Feb 22 01:19:26 alpha2 kernel: [116476.085905] saa7146 (0) saa7146_i2c_writeout [irq]: timed out waiting for end of xfer
Feb 22 01:19:26 alpha2 kernel: [116476.128119] saa7146 (0) saa7146_i2c_writeout [irq]: timed out waiting for end of xfer
Feb 22 01:19:26 alpha2 kernel: [116476.168091] saa7146 (0) saa7146_i2c_writeout [irq]: timed out waiting for end of xfer
Feb 22 01:19:26 alpha2 kernel: [116476.218061] saa7146 (0) saa7146_i2c_writeout [irq]: timed out waiting for end of xfer
Feb 22 01:19:26 alpha2 kernel: [116476.238064] DVB: TDA10023(0): tda10023_readreg: readreg error (reg == 0x11, ret == -5)
Running on a Asus p8p67 with a 2600CPU/16Gb ram and 8Tb RAID5 array.
Note the system was running on a quad core2 for almost 2years with out any major problems. The nobody cared errors started after upgrading the motherboard. The error can take upto a week for it to appear. I'm now testing with the irqpoll kernel parameter......
